Output 50c28f13153dc30ddb77817dd3ce0a3375031a39913c9fa36cc4f6a29b704ef6:0
- value
- 657326
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bd5ee6e08285142bfb796591c6f0262c179dc7f OP_EQUAL
- address
- 34ECSwBwZNssLKYx9Z71mYrjQ462qu2tf7
- transaction
- 50c28f13153dc30ddb77817dd3ce0a3375031a39913c9fa36cc4f6a29b704ef6
- spent
- true